-
SWITCH PUSHBUTTON SPST 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
TAP227M006CRS
KYOCERA AVX
M2-500
Mark-10
1293-50-S
RAF Electronic Hardware
FNY-W6003-20
Omron Automation and Safety
RN73R2BTTD1100A05
KOA Speer Electronics, Inc.